Q: Is 171,642,818 a Prime Number?
A: No, 171,642,818 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 171642818 can be evenly divided by 1 2 85,821,409 and 171,642,818, with no remainder.
Since 171,642,818 cannot be divided by just 1 and 171,642,818, it is not a prime number.
